Joy Asghar Blueyonder wrote: > Have checked on ancestry for 1891 looked under Shropshire Alberbury is > listed. Perhaps your family are mistranscribed. > Ancestry appear to have Alberbury ED1 only. The family that Roy is looking for lived in ED2 which is not on Ancestry's site. This idea that Ancestry offer "complete" censuses is simply not true! I have just had to purchase the 1851 Denbighshire census on CD from S&N Genealogy because Ancestry do not have the 1851 census for Ruabon on-line. I informed Ancestry of this missing parish several months ago but, as their policy is not to reply to emails (confirmed by their own staff at the Family History Fair 2006 in London), I have no idea if they intend doing anything about it!
